History

Zillow claims the house was built in 1912, but it is definietly older than that, as it appears in the 1910 census.

1910 census: Plumber Frederick is living with his wife and 2 children.

In 1942, Sloan & Lynch, on behalf of the Lowdens, sold the home to Wilton White and his wife for $8,500. Wilton died in 1949, and their son Robert Gregory White was attending Drexel University for a degree in mechanical engineering.

1950 census: Michigan-origin widow Helen is living alone.

In 1951, the residence was home to Robert H. Carruthers, which means that Helen had likely moved by that time. In 1957, Harold Darnell lived there. In 1980, Ewen Cameron, who originally resided at 311 Davis Road, purchased the home for $59,000, and he sold the home to Geoffrey Aguirre and Isolde Baylor for $265,000. The house sold again in 2011 for $410,000.
